Kettle安装与使用指南
概述
Kettle是一款开源的ETL(Extract-Transform-Load)工具,由纯Java编写,支持在Windows、Linux和Unix系统上运行。它无需安装,数据抽取高效稳定,广泛应用于数据集成和转换领域。
主要特点
- 开源免费:Kettle是一款完全开源的工具,用户可以自由下载和使用。
- 跨平台支持:支持Windows、Linux和Unix系统,满足不同环境的需求。
- 绿色无需安装:解压即可使用,无需复杂的安装过程。
- 高效稳定:数据抽取和转换过程高效稳定,适用于企业级数据处理。
工程存储方式
Kettle的工程存储方式主要有两种:
- XML形式存储:将工程文件以XML格式存储。
- 资源库方式存储:支持数据库资源库和文件资源库,便于管理和共享。
设计类型
Kettle中有两种主要的设计类型:
- Transformation(转换):后缀为
.ktr
,主要用于基础数据转换。 - Job(作业):后缀为
.kjb
,用于控制整个工作流的执行。
安装步骤
Windows系统
- 安装JDK:确保已安装JDK,并配置好环境变量。
- 下载Kettle压缩包:从官方网站下载Kettle压缩包,解压到任意本地路径。
- 启动Kettle:双击
Spoon.bat
文件,启动图形化界面工具。
Linux系统
- 安装JDK:确保已安装JDK,并配置好环境变量。
- 下载Kettle压缩包:从官方网站下载Kettle压缩包,解压到任意本地路径。
- 启动Kettle:在终端中运行
./Spoon.sh
文件,启动图形化界面工具。
简单使用
- 配置资源库与数据库:启动Kettle工具后,点击
DB连接
,新建并编辑数据库连接,测试成功后保存。 - 创建转换业务:点击
核心对象
,选择输入-->表输入
和输出-->Excel
,设置相关参数后运行并保存脚本。
总结
Kettle是一款功能强大的ETL工具,适用于各种数据集成和转换任务。通过简单的安装和配置,用户可以快速上手并应用于实际项目中。希望本指南能帮助您顺利安装和使用Kettle。